Gaters have new faces
We received feedback saying that Gaters’ faces lacked life. While we had an artistic direction for the faces, we wanted to try out a new design. It is still in progress but we can already show you what we plan with these new faces!
First off, here’s a short before/after to show you the difference between the old work and the new result.
Side note: We’ve received feedback about these new faces too! They’re not perfect and we’ll continue to improve them in the future!
Then, we added expressions to their faces. They’ll mainly be used during missions so instead of having a neutral face all along, Gaters can express their surprise, excitement, frustration and more according to the situation!
Also, we added facial expressions so they reflect their condition inside the base, here they are:

Remember the Star Map? We're redesigning it too!
The Star Map issue was to try to make it visually interesting, stable despite the procedural generation and easy to navigate. It’s not totally finished yet. Redesigning the Star Map brings up many challenges such as:
- setting clear icons indicating which kind of resource you can earn by exploring an exoplanet
- Adding a progression system as Gaters perform missions
- defining the difficulty level concept in an understandable way and adding missions in accordance with the difficulty level displayed
- having colors adapted to color-blind people
The Tech Tree, which allows you to unlock new technologies to upgrade your base and progress in the game, will also be redesigned!
